On January 12, 2007, world-renowned violinist Joshua Bell played incognito in a busy subway station. Thousands of commuters passed by without stopping. Elder Dieter F. Uchtdorf uses this story to remind us of the importance of pausing in our busy lives to hear the sublime yet often subtle voice of the Spirit. As we slow down and listen, we will be able to hear the music of the Spirit, and it will help and uplift us.
